I have around 100 oz frozen milk, dating back to May 2012. Baby born mid-April healthy, happy and now, appropriately chubby. Currently I take a prenatal, Vit D, and calcium. I've taken more milk plus and goat's rue for lactation. Although all was frozen w/in 72 h and most w/in 24, I have a lipase issue so your baby should be not picky about taste.
